Hello, recently I've tried to upload several rois to BL using CLI, however I'm constantly encountering the error during data validation step, which prevents me for doing so. Below I'll describe the way I'm processing and what happens:
- I create a folder tmp which contains a subfolder named
rois(tmp/rois). Insideroisfolder there are several files with binary masks, all in .nii.gz format - I'm uploading the data with given command
bl dataset upload --directory Tmp/${subj_BL}/tmp \
--project $project_id \
--datatype neuro/rois \
--datatype_tag 'aligned' \
--subject $subj_BL \
--desc 'Test' \
--tag 'test' \
--force
- On the terminal prompt I receive a following message
__dtv(brainlife/validator-neuro-rois) Brain Life
__dtv(brainlife/validator-neuro-rois)
failed
loading error.log
(node:1954) UnhandledPromiseRejectionWarning: Error: Traceback (most recent call last):
File "/mnt/datalad/upload/5fbf83ed47b8ca08393100cf/5fce6c3ad89d012ca55d0c19/validate.py", line 27, in <module>
roispath=config["rois"]
KeyError: 'rois'
at util.waitForFinish (/usr/lib/node_modules/brainlife/bl-dataset-upload.js:239:43)
at <anonymous>
at process._tickCallback (internal/process/next_tick.js:189:7)
(node:1954) UnhandledPromiseRejectionWarning: Unhandled promise rejection. This error originated either by throwing inside of an async function without a catch block, or by rejecting a promise which was not handled with .catch(). (rejection id: 1)
(node:1954) [DEP0018] DeprecationWarning: Unhandled promise rejections are deprecated. In the future, promise rejections that are not handled will terminate the Node.js process with a non-zero exit code.
- I can't figure out why
configvariable has no fieldrois, nor what I can do to change that. I've also tried uploading the rois together with associatedlabel.json, but this didn't make a difference.
